Q: What should I bring for clothing?
A: Depending upon the season you sail on Quest, Spring dictates layers,, mornings are cool while afternoons can warm up quickly. Summer would allow bathing suits, tee's & shorts, and wrapping up fall sailing,, comes around to layers again! Fleece is always a good idea and having rain gear that is water proof and  breathable should be packed in every bag for all season sailing. Good deck shoes are a must, but please NO black soled shoes or sneakers. Please, no sandals while sailing as it is key to protect your feet with closed toes.
